Full Recipe
Ingredients:
For the Banana Brownie Layer:
-
1/2 cup unsalted butter, melted
-
1 cup granulated sugar
-
2 large eggs
-
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
-
1 cup mashed ripe bananas (about 2 large)
-
1 cup all-purpose flour
-
1/2 teaspoon baking powder
-
1/4 teaspoon baking soda
-
1/4 teaspoon salt
For the Cream Cheese Frosting:
-
4 ounces cream cheese, softened
-
1/4 cup unsalted butter, softened
-
1 cup powdered sugar
-
1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ract
Directions:
-
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ease or line an 8×8-inch baking pan.
-
In a large mixing bowl, stir together melted butter and sugar until combined.
-
Add eggs and vanilla extract, then whisk until smooth.
-
Stir in mashed bananas.
-
In a separate bowl, whisk together flour, baking powder, baking soda, and salt.
-
Fold dry ingredients into the wet ingredients until just combined—do not overmix.
-
Pour batter into prepared pan and spread evenly.
-
Bake for 25–30 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ean.
-
Let cool completely in the pan.
-
To make the frosting, beat together cream cheese and butter until fluffy.
-
Add powdered sugar and vanilla extract, and beat until smooth.
-
Spread frosting evenly over cooled banana brownies. Cut into squares and serve.
Prep Time: 10 minutes | Cooking Time: 30 minutes | Total Time: 40 minutes
Kcal: 285 kcal | Servings: 9 servings

How to Customize
One of the best things about Banana Bread Brownies is how easily you can adapt them to suit your preferences. If you love nuts, feel free to fold in some chopped walnuts or pecans for crunch. Want a little chocolate in the mix? Add a handful of chocolate chips or drizzle melted chocolate over the frosting.
You can also play around with the frosting. While the standard cream cheese version is incredibly satisfying, a peanut butter frosting or a simple glaze of powdered sugar and milk can add a new twist. Dairy-free alternatives are easy to substitute too—vegan butter and cream cheese work just as well if you’re avoiding animal products.
Storage and Shelf Life
Banana Bread Brownies are best stored in an airtight container in the refrigerator, especially if they’re frosted. They will keep well for about 4–5 days, maintaining both their texture and flavor. If you prefer a room temperature experience, simply let them sit out for 15–20 minutes before serving.
For longer storage, wrap individual bars tightly in plastic wrap and freeze. They’ll stay good for up to two months. When you’re ready to eat, just thaw them at room temperature or give them a quick warm-up in the microwave.

Tips for Success
To ensure your Banana Bread Brownies turn out perfectly every time, here are a few tips:
-
Use very ripe bananas for the best flavor and moisture content. The blacker the peel, the better.
-
Don’t overmix the batter—this will keep the texture light and tender.
-
Let the bars cool completely before frosting to prevent the topping from melting.
-
For clean slices, use a sharp knife wiped clean between cuts.
These simple practices can make a big difference in your final product and help you create bakery-quality brownies right in your own kitchen.
